A grand jury clears another officer in a controversial death, this time in the chokehold of unarmed African American Eric Garner. Protesters converge on central points in Manhattan, while police watch on in the hundreds, blocking access to Rockefeller Center and the surrounding area.

 

Manhattan, New York

December 3, 2014

16/04/2016: An estimated 150,000 people marched through Central London to protest against government austerity policies which are having serious impacts on public health, housing, employment, wages and education. Organised by The People's Assembly, the "March for Health, Homes, Jobs & Education" protesters represented junior doctors, nurses, NHS workers, teachers, students, firefighters, disability rights and welfare rights campaigners, local government employees and a wide cross section of aggrieved citizens who claim that they are being unjustly impoverished by an uncaring Conservative government which is purposefully dismantling public services and handing them to private capital to fund tax relief for the wealthiest.

 

An extra post-Panama Papers data leak flavour prevailed at the protest with many people carrying "Dodgy Dave" placards - a reference to Prime Minister David Cameron's recent painfully drawn-out admission over four days that he has personally benefitted from the use of offshore tax havens set up by his late father.

Protest in the ethnically cleansed city of Prijedor. Marchers walk with backpacks with the names and ages of children killed in the genocide. The protest was granted on the condition they didn't say the word "genocide". In the center of the town the backpacks were set down to spell out "GENOCID?".

 

Photos of the 20th Anniversary of the closing of Serb-Run concentration camps in northwest Bosnia near the town of Prijedor.
